Leading Edge NZ selected as finalist in AUT Excellence in Business Support Awards

Leading Edge NZ has been selected as a finalist in the 2016 AUT Business School Excellence in Business Support Awards.

Recognised for excellence in the Large Business category, Leading Edge NZ will join finalists across ten categories at this year’s awards.

“It is a great achievement to be recognised as a finalist in the 2016 Excellence in Business Support Awards. Our New Zealand operation is a leading sales organisation that has an award winning culture and delivers great outcomes for our channel partners’ and their customers,” says Struan Abernethy, Leading Edge Group CEO. IBM Press Release:  Auckland, New Zealand – 25 Sep 2015: IBM Kenexa (NYSE: IBM) today announced the finalists of its annual Best Workplaces Survey and Awards, New Zealand’s largest and longest running study of workplace climate and employee engagement. This year over 30,000 employees from 193 New Zealand organisations in the private and public sectors participated, with 40 workplaces reaching finalist status across five categories: Small, Small-Medium, Medium-Large, Large and Enterprise.
